How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Town Country Manor?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Town Country Manor Studio Apartments | $1,590 | $749 | $3,046 |
Town Country Manor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,488 | $653 | $3,683 |
Town Country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,982 | $781 | $6,627 |
Town Country Manor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,455 | $1,109 | $4,496 |

Getting Around the Town Country Manor Neighborhood in Milwaukee, WI
Walk Score®
32 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
51 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
45 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
